An event-driven, bidirectional Flash socket server written in Python using 
Twisted and PyAMF. 

SwfConduit allows you to asynchronously communicate between the server and 
clients by passing event objects over a bidirectional AMF3 socket. SwfConduit 
uses full objects, so no messing around with serialization on either client
or server, it all happens automatically!

This is a 1.0 release. It contains:

1) An event-based client library for async communication with the SWFConduit server
written in AS3
2) An OO server system based on Twisted and PyAMF

SwfConduit Requirements:

1) Python 2.6
2) Twisted
3) PyAMF 0.6 (available from http://pyamf.org)

Client Requirements:

1) AMF3
         - AMF0 does not support full object serialization
2) Flash clients require AS3
         - AS1/2 do not support raw binary sockets

To run SwfConduit:

    twistd -ny swfconduit.tac

To build modules for SwfConduit, look at 

    1) swfconduit.server
        A server. Each application should have one
    2) swfconduit.session
        Keeps track of session state. Extend to add more tracking
    3) swfconduit.event
        A message to/from client/server. Each type of message needs an Event class

Be sure to edit the socket-policy.xml file for each server you add.
